-struct voya_alloc_entry {
- struct list_head list;
- unsigned long ofs;
- unsigned long len;
-};
-
-static DEFINE_SPINLOCK(voya_list_lock);
-static LIST_HEAD(voya_alloc_list);
-
-#define OHCI_SRAM_START 0xb0000000
-#define OHCI_HCCA_SIZE 0x100
-#define OHCI_SRAM_SIZE 0x10000
-
-void *voyagergx_consistent_alloc(struct device *dev, size_t size,
- dma_addr_t *handle, gfp_t flag)
-{
- struct list_head *list = &voya_alloc_list;
- struct voya_alloc_entry *entry;
- struct sh_dev *shdev = to_sh_dev(dev);
- unsigned long start, end;
- unsigned long flags;
-
- /*
- * The SM501 contains an integrated 8051 with its own SRAM.
- * Devices within the cchip can all hook into the 8051 SRAM.
- * We presently use this for the OHCI.
- *
- * Everything else goes through consistent_alloc().
- */
- if (!dev || dev->bus != &sh_bus_types[SH_BUS_VIRT] ||
- (dev->bus == &sh_bus_types[SH_BUS_VIRT] &&
- shdev->dev_id != SH_DEV_ID_USB_OHCI))
- return NULL;
-
- start = OHCI_SRAM_START + OHCI_HCCA_SIZE;
-
- entry = kmalloc(sizeof(struct voya_alloc_entry), GFP_ATOMIC);
- if (!entry)
- return ERR_PTR(-ENOMEM);
-
- entry->len = (size + 15) & ~15;
-
- /*
- * The basis for this allocator is dwmw2's malloc.. the
- * Matrox allocator :-)
- */
- spin_lock_irqsave(&voya_list_lock, flags);
- list_for_each(list, &voya_alloc_list) {
- struct voya_alloc_entry *p;
-
- p = list_entry(list, struct voya_alloc_entry, list);
-
- if (p->ofs - start >= size)
- goto out;
-
- start = p->ofs + p->len;
- }
-
- end = start + (OHCI_SRAM_SIZE - OHCI_HCCA_SIZE);
- list = &voya_alloc_list;
-
- if (end - start >= size) {
-out:
- entry->ofs = start;
- list_add_tail(&entry->list, list);
- spin_unlock_irqrestore(&voya_list_lock, flags);
-
- *handle = start;
- return (void *)start;
- }
-
- kfree(entry);
- spin_unlock_irqrestore(&voya_list_lock, flags);
-
- return ERR_PTR(-EINVAL);
-}
-
-int voyagergx_consistent_free(struct device *dev, size_t size,
- void *vaddr, dma_addr_t handle)
-{
- struct voya_alloc_entry *entry;
- struct sh_dev *shdev = to_sh_dev(dev);
- unsigned long flags;
-
- if (!dev || dev->bus != &sh_bus_types[SH_BUS_VIRT] ||
- (dev->bus == &sh_bus_types[SH_BUS_VIRT] &&
- shdev->dev_id != SH_DEV_ID_USB_OHCI))
- return -EINVAL;
-
- spin_lock_irqsave(&voya_list_lock, flags);
- list_for_each_entry(entry, &voya_alloc_list, list) {
- if (entry->ofs != handle)
- continue;
-
- list_del(&entry->list);
- kfree(entry);
-
- break;
- }
- spin_unlock_irqrestore(&voya_list_lock, flags);
-
- return 0;
-}
-
-EXPORT_SYMBOL(voyagergx_consistent_alloc);
-EXPORT_SYMBOL(voyagergx_consistent_free);

-static void disable_voyagergx_irq(unsigned int irq)
-{
- unsigned long flags, val;
- unsigned long mask = 1 << (irq - VOYAGER_IRQ_BASE);
-
- pr_debug("disable_voyagergx_irq(%d): mask=%x\n", irq, mask);
- local_irq_save(flags);
- val = inl(VOYAGER_INT_MASK);
- val &= ~mask;
- outl(val, VOYAGER_INT_MASK);
- local_irq_restore(flags);
-}
-
-
-static void enable_voyagergx_irq(unsigned int irq)
-{
- unsigned long flags, val;
- unsigned long mask = 1 << (irq - VOYAGER_IRQ_BASE);
-
- pr_debug("disable_voyagergx_irq(%d): mask=%x\n", irq, mask);
- local_irq_save(flags);
- val = inl(VOYAGER_INT_MASK);
- val |= mask;
- outl(val, VOYAGER_INT_MASK);
- local_irq_restore(flags);
-}
-
-
-static void mask_and_ack_voyagergx(unsigned int irq)
-{
- disable_voyagergx_irq(irq);
-}
-
-static void end_voyagergx_irq(unsigned int irq)
-{
- if (!(irq_desc[irq].status & (IRQ_DISABLED|IRQ_INPROGRESS)))
- enable_voyagergx_irq(irq);
-}
-
-static unsigned int startup_voyagergx_irq(unsigned int irq)
-{
- enable_voyagergx_irq(irq);
- return 0;
-}
-
-static void shutdown_voyagergx_irq(unsigned int irq)
-{
- disable_voyagergx_irq(irq);
-}
-
-static struct hw_interrupt_type voyagergx_irq_type = {
- .typename = "VOYAGERGX-IRQ",
- .startup = startup_voyagergx_irq,
- .shutdown = shutdown_voyagergx_irq,
- .enable = enable_voyagergx_irq,
- .disable = disable_voyagergx_irq,
- .ack = mask_and_ack_voyagergx,
- .end = end_voyagergx_irq,
-};
-
-static irqreturn_t voyagergx_interrupt(int irq, void *dev_id, struct pt_regs *regs)
-{
- printk(KERN_INFO
- "VoyagerGX: spurious interrupt, status: 0x%x\n",
- inl(INT_STATUS));
- return IRQ_HANDLED;
-}
-
-
-/*====================================================*/
-
-static struct {
- int (*func)(int, void *);
- void *dev;
-} voyagergx_demux[VOYAGER_IRQ_NUM];
-
-void voyagergx_register_irq_demux(int irq,
- int (*demux)(int irq, void *dev), void *dev)
-{
- voyagergx_demux[irq - VOYAGER_IRQ_BASE].func = demux;
- voyagergx_demux[irq - VOYAGER_IRQ_BASE].dev = dev;
-}
-
-void voyagergx_unregister_irq_demux(int irq)
-{
- voyagergx_demux[irq - VOYAGER_IRQ_BASE].func = 0;
-}
-
-int voyagergx_irq_demux(int irq)
-{
-
- if (irq == IRQ_VOYAGER ) {
- unsigned long i = 0, bit __attribute__ ((unused));
- unsigned long val = inl(INT_STATUS);
-#if 1
- if ( val & ( 1 << 1 )){
- i = 1;
- } else if ( val & ( 1 << 2 )){
- i = 2;
- } else if ( val & ( 1 << 6 )){
- i = 6;
- } else if( val & ( 1 << 10 )){
- i = 10;
- } else if( val & ( 1 << 11 )){
- i = 11;
- } else if( val & ( 1 << 12 )){
- i = 12;
- } else if( val & ( 1 << 17 )){
- i = 17;
- } else {
- printk("Unexpected IRQ irq = %d status = 0x%08lx\n", irq, val);
- }
- pr_debug("voyagergx_irq_demux %d \n", i);
-#else
- for (bit = 1, i = 0 ; i < VOYAGER_IRQ_NUM ; bit <<= 1, i++)
- if (val & bit)
- break;
-#endif
- if (i < VOYAGER_IRQ_NUM) {
- irq = VOYAGER_IRQ_BASE + i;
- if (voyagergx_demux[i].func != 0)
- irq = voyagergx_demux[i].func(irq, voyagergx_demux[i].dev);
- }
- }
- return irq;
-}
-
-static struct irqaction irq0 = { voyagergx_interrupt, SA_INTERRUPT, 0, "VOYAGERGX", NULL, NULL};
-
-void __init setup_voyagergx_irq(void)
-{
- int i, flag;
-
- printk(KERN_INFO "VoyagerGX configured at 0x%x on irq %d(mapped into %d to %d)\n",
- VOYAGER_BASE,
- IRQ_VOYAGER,
- VOYAGER_IRQ_BASE,
- VOYAGER_IRQ_BASE + VOYAGER_IRQ_NUM - 1);
-
- for (i=0; i<VOYAGER_IRQ_NUM; i++) {
- flag = 0;
- switch (VOYAGER_IRQ_BASE + i) {
- case VOYAGER_USBH_IRQ:
- case VOYAGER_8051_IRQ:
- case VOYAGER_UART0_IRQ:
- case VOYAGER_UART1_IRQ:
- case VOYAGER_AC97_IRQ:
- flag = 1;
- }
- if (flag == 1)
- irq_desc[VOYAGER_IRQ_BASE + i].handler = &voyagergx_irq_type;
- }
-
- setup_irq(IRQ_VOYAGER, &irq0);
-}
